Output 8c58083b42411e26e386833b5f1ab1a1e0e1401f8eb91320651e124dd0a1bfbe:2

value
5856494
script pubkey
OP_0 OP_PUSHBYTES_20 c2810aa15e267b59f94c0de4dcf465d17b98d4f9
address
bc1qc2qs4g27yea4n72vphjdear969ae348etyvx3g
transaction
8c58083b42411e26e386833b5f1ab1a1e0e1401f8eb91320651e124dd0a1bfbe
spent
true